This charming two bedroom Victorian house is ideally positioned just a short distance from Sudbury town centre offering convenient access to local shops and transport links.

The property is well presented throughout and boasts characterful finish that blends modern day with period charm. Offered to the market with no onward chain, this delightful home is one not to miss!

This charming period home welcomes you in with an entrance porch leading directly into a bright and spacious sitting room. Large front-facing sash windows let in lots of natural light, while the central fireplace and continuous laminate flooring create a warm and cosy feel.

The dining room continues the sense of space, offering rear-aspect sash windows and direct access to both the staircase and the well-appointed kitchen. The kitchen is fully fitted and thoughtfully designed, featuring an L shaped worktop, induction hob, tiled splashbacks, and space for essential appliances. A rear door and sash window provide pleasant views over the garden.

Upstairs, you will find two comfortable double bedrooms. The principal bedroom enjoys front-aspect sash windows and a double built in wardrobe with mirrored sliding doors, adding to the sense of light and space. The second bedroom offers peaceful rear views, a wall mounted radiator, and ample space for additional furniture. The family bathroom includes a panelled bath with tiled surround, WC, wash basin, radiator with towel rail, airing cupboard, and a rear-aspect window.

Outside
A useful side passage beneath bedroom one provides access to the rear courtyard garden and also serves as a shared route for the neighbouring property. The low maintenance garden features a mix of shingle and patio, enclosed by fencing, and offers a lovely outlook toward the historic All Saints Church - a charming backdrop to enjoy year round.

The property is situated to the front of All Saints Church and is a short walk in to Sudbury town centre where you will find local amenities, boutique shops, cafes, restaurants and the train station next to the Sudbury leisure centre.

Location

The property is found in the old part of Sudbury and benefits from being walking distance to riverside walks as well as Sudbury town centre. Sudbury itself is a thriving and expanding market town with a good range of local amenities including a branch rail to London Liverpool Street via Marks Tey. There is a good local bus service and a range of boutique shops as well as high street brand names along with supermarkets including Waitrose, Sainsburys, Tesco and Aldi.
